Hunter's Chicken with Wine and Mushrooms — Poulet Chasseur

The hunter's chicken of classical French bistro cooking, browned thighs braised in white wine, tomato and mushrooms with tarragon.

Instructions

1

Prep

Pat chicken thighs dry, season with salt and pepper. Toss potatoes with olive oil and salt. Quarter mushrooms, finely chop shallots and garlic. Chop tarragon and parsley. Have wine, stock, cognac, tomato paste, tomatoes, thyme, and bay leaf ready.

2

Roast

Spread potatoes on a baking tray, roast at 200°C for 35 minutes until tender and golden, shaking halfway. Set aside when done.

3

Sear

Heat neutral oil in a heavy pan over medium-high. Sear chicken skin-side down 7 minutes until deep golden, flip and sear 3 minutes. Transfer to a plate.

4

Saute

Reduce heat to medium, add butter and mushrooms, sauté 5 minutes until golden and liquid evaporates. Add shallots and garlic, sauté 3 minutes until soft.

5

Build

Off heat, add cognac, return to flame and reduce 30 seconds. Stir in tomato paste and flour, cook 1 minute. Pour wine, scrape base clean. Add tomatoes, stock, thyme, and bay. Return chicken skin-side up with juices.

6

Braise

Simmer gently uncovered over medium-low heat 20–22 minutes until chicken is cooked through and sauce coats a spoon. Stir in half the tarragon.

7

Plate

Transfer chicken and sauce to a serving bowl, scatter remaining tarragon and parsley over top. Serve with roasted potatoes and green salad alongside.
